    Yeah, I know...most campgrounds along I-5 are not overly awesome. I am looking for a decent one in southern Oregon/Northern Cali that folks like enough for a one night stay, that is safe for a lady and her kid, has good access to the freeway, and you would go to. Was hoping to get to Medford at the very least (looking at Valley of the Rogue SP as the furthest north). Do others have suggestions for a little further south?

    Indian Mary is a great park on the Rogue River, but it's about 15 minutes off of the freeway at Merlin (just north of Grants Pass).

    We stayed last year on our way to Lake Shasta for the Dam Gathering we stayed at Seven Feathers RV park. It is part of the Seven Feathers Casino.

    Real great park with indoor pool, private showers and rest rooms. About $30.00 nite.
